Ridgecrest South Residential Community

Tuscaloosa, Alabama

This 5-story, 962-bed student residence includes a 1,025-car parking structure built into the hillside, rendering it invisible from the eastern side. The project features a concrete frame wrapped in a brick-and-stucco exterior. Hoar's QC process began early in design with a thorough constructability review. Our extensive dorm construction experience has taught us that an installation problem early in a repetitive project results in a quality disaster. We developed specific QC plans that focused on several areas, especially bathroom plumbing and shower pans, to prevent leaks. Water intrusion was a key area for monitoring, with close attention on flashings and masonry attachments and installation of stucco, roofs, waterproofing and coatings. Each was inspected at every point in construction by Hoar's superintendent. Because the constructability reviews occurred early in design, quality construction methods were developed and incorporated before work began on site, adding no additional costs to the project.
